Frequently Asked Questions about King County
How much are Studio apartments in King County?
There are currently 1,808 Studio Apartments in King County with rent ranges from $740 to $8,950 with an average price of $1,717.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om King County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in King County ranges from $620 to $9,562 with an average monthly rent of $2,389.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in King County c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in King County range from $805 to $25,100.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,134.
How expensive are King County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 938 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in King County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,075 to $31,995 - averaging $3,535 for the location.
